The internet slang termzing” means to make a witty or clever comment that is intended to mock or embarrass someone. It is often used to deliver a quick, sharp, and often humorous comeback or insult in online conversations. Here are two practical examples of how this term can be used in sentences:

1. During an online debate:
User A: I think pineapple on pizza is delicious!
User B: Well, I guess we all have different taste buds. Some of us prefer to enjoy our pizza instead of ruining it with pineapple.
User C: Zing! User B just dropped the mic with that comment!

2. In a social media conversation:
User X: Just finished watching the latest episode of that show, and I wasn’t impressed at all. It’s so predictable! 🙄
User Y: Sorry, watching you try to predict the next plot twist would be more entertaining than the show itself. Zing! 😂
